After losing to Towson the last time they met, Hereford decided to demonstrate that turnabout is fair play. The Hereford Bulls walked away with a 50-40 win over the Towson Generals on Wednesday.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Bulls.
Towson's defeat came despite a true team effort from the offense,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Seven Wheeler, who went 5 of 10 en route to 15 points. Korey Collins was another key player, putting up eight points.
Hereford has been performing well recently as they've won five of their last six contests, which provided a nice bump to their 8-9 record this season. As for Towson, their loss dropped their record down to 8-10.
Hereford has already played their next matchup (against Lansdowne), but no score has been uploaded at the time of writing. Towson will be playing at home against Randallstown at 5:30 p.m. on Friday. Randallstown knows how to get points on the board -- the squad has finished with 55 points or more in their past seven games -- so hopefully Towson likes a good challenge.
